About Disability Insurance Law in Kingston, Australia:

Disability Insurance in Kingston, Australia provides financial protection for individuals who are unable to work due to a disability. This type of insurance can help cover medical expenses, lost wages, and other costs associated with a disability.

Frequently Asked Questions:

1. Can I apply for Disability Insurance if I have a pre-existing condition?

Yes, you may still be eligible for Disability Insurance in Kingston, Australia even if you have a pre-existing condition. However, the insurance company may require additional documentation or medical evaluations.

2. How long does it take to receive benefits after filing a claim?

The timeline for receiving benefits can vary depending on the complexity of your claim and the insurance company's processing times. In some cases, benefits may be paid out within a few weeks, while others may take several months.

3. What should I do if my Disability Insurance claim is denied?

If your Disability Insurance claim is denied, you have the right to appeal the decision. It is recommended to seek legal advice to help you navigate the appeals process and increase your chances of a successful outcome.

4. Are there any deadlines for filing a Disability Insurance claim?

Yes, there are usually time limits for filing a Disability Insurance claim in Kingston, Australia. It is important to be aware of these deadlines and ensure that you submit your claim within the specified timeframe.

5. Can I work part-time while receiving Disability Insurance benefits?

Some Disability Insurance policies in Kingston, Australia may allow for part-time work while still receiving benefits. However, it is crucial to review your policy terms and consult with a lawyer to avoid any potential issues.

6. What types of disabilities are covered by Disability Insurance?

Disability Insurance in Kingston, Australia may cover a wide range of disabilities, including physical, mental, and chronic illnesses. It is important to review your policy to understand the specific conditions that are covered.

7. Can I switch Disability Insurance policies?

It is possible to switch Disability Insurance policies in Kingston, Australia, but it is recommended to consult with a lawyer before making any changes. There may be implications for your coverage and benefits when switching policies.

8. Are there financial limits on Disability Insurance benefits?

Some Disability Insurance policies in Kingston, Australia may have financial limits on benefits, such as a maximum weekly or monthly payout. It is essential to review your policy to understand any financial restrictions that may apply.
